Flimflam is when someone plans a complicated scheme for tricking people out of their property or money. Some persons spell it this way "flim flam". Many flimflams are some version of a con, or "confidence game," in which the con artist first gains the trust or confidence of the victim, and then swindles money from him/her.
The most common form of this crime involves confusing a store cashier by trying to change large denomination notes and swapping money back and forth, until the cashier loses track of the transactions — and a bunch of money.
